The primary airport serving the city of Colombo is Bandaranaike International Airport, also known as Colombo International Airport. Currently there are three airlines offering direct flights from Dubai to Colombo - SriLankan Airlines, Emirates and flydubai. All of the flights to Colombo from Dubai leave Dubai International Airport as opposed to the Al Maktoum International Airport. Colombo is also home to Ratmalana Airport, Sri Lanka's only international airport before Bandaranaike International Airport opened in 1967. This airport offers domestic flights in addition to charter flights.

Airport Information - Arriving

Bandaranaike International Airport is made up of two passenger terminals as well as a third terminal which is due to open in 2019. Terminal 1 is the largest in the airport and currently operates all international flights, while Terminal 3 is dedicated to domestic operations. The planned Terminal 2 is scheduled to open in 2019 and will eventually take over many international flight routes. Passengers traveling to and from Dubai will be at Terminal 1 which offers a lot in terms of duty free shops, eateries and airport lounges.

There are numerous ways to reach the center of Colombo from Bandaranaike International Airport including by public bus and airport taxi. Car rental is also an option. All travelers, except citizens of Singapore and Maldives, must apply for an electronic travel authorization (ETA) before entering the country. This visa is valid for a period of up to 3 months for two entries into the country, although the maximum length of stay is up to 30 days.

Airport Information - Departing

All flights to Colombo depart from Dubai International Airport, one of the world's finest airports offering a wide range of amenities and facilities. The airport is comprised of three passenger terminals - Terminal 3 is dedicated solely to Emirates flights, while Terminals 1 and 2 handle all other airlines. Those flying with SriLankan Airlines will depart from Terminal 1, and those with flydubai will leave from Terminal 2. Dubai International Airport offers a wealth of world-class designer stores, duty free shopping, restaurants and airport lounges and also ranks as the world's busiest airport.

Colombo Travel Tips

The weather in Colombo remains consistently hot all year round as it lacks any season where temperatures are cooler, unlike Dubai where the winter months can be pleasantly cool. However, Colombo does have two monsoon seasons between May-August and October-January, so those looking forward to exploring the city and the surrounding region will want to avoid these periods. Prices are a lot cheaper compared to Dubai, reflected in the average cost of a meal for two at around 50AED compared to 200AED in Dubai. Those journeying to Colombo should be aware that the city is 1.5 hours ahead of Dubai.
